HAI CL-1000nc Non-Contact Clinical Specular Microscope
HAI Labs, Inc.
The CL-1000nc is quick and easy to use, capturing endothelial cell images automatically without any click of a button. The software provides quick reference data for cell density, coefficient of variation and hexagonal percentage within a matter of seconds, while a built-in pachymeter gives the thickness of the cornea. Its non-contact design makes the procedure comfortable for patients and efficient for busy practices.

Visual Testing Systems
This selection of visual testing systems highlights the fact that each have their strong points and are all slightly different from one another. Visual testing systems, when used in electrophysiological studies, allow the evalutation of photopic visual processes as well as scotopic vision. Others offer the assessment of both red-green and blue-yellow discrimination via hue tests and anomoloscopes.
